Output 0909846ff4aceccceb9616fd4e6df747af2acb86816995349e2022fed7b73ca8:1

value
25409511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e28bba89b480c0223caa63c533fa27a200a1c11 OP_EQUAL
address
35u5oYp54PpvLfeFiNnshP6HJNUAbzg8ny
transaction
0909846ff4aceccceb9616fd4e6df747af2acb86816995349e2022fed7b73ca8
confirmations
393034
spent
true